SATYRYKON LEGNICA 2008 /
Poland
Legnica's SATYRYKON is an event unique and unrivalled event in
Poland. It is also highly ranked in the world. The American magazine
'Witty World' included it among 10 best festivals awarding it its
Grand Prix, and FECO (The Federation of Cartoonist Organisation)
awarded it its maximum, 5 star' note .
PARTICIPATION CONDITIONS
The SATYRYKON 2008 International Exhibition is an open competition.
The objects of the competition are drawings, graphics and other
works of fine arts and photography created with the use of optional
techniques, being originals, completed within the recent two years
(2007-2008), and qualified by artists to:
HUMOR and SOCIAL SATIRE
(drawing without captions preferred)
D O G
I feel, I love, I Wait and bark
(drawing without captions preferred)
WORKS AWARDED IN OTHER COMPETITIONSwill be excluded from the
competition.
The format of the works - maximum A3 (297 x 420 mm).

PRIZES:
Works for the competition will be qualified by the International
Jury.
The Jury will award the following prizes:
GRAND PRIX SATYRYKON 2008
- pure gold key and purse amounting to 5.500 PLN
2 gold medals and purses amounting to 5.000 PLN
2 silver medals and purses amounting to 4.500 PLN
2 bronze medals and purses amounting to 4.000 PLN
4 special prizes amounting to 3.500 PLN each
The Legnica Culture Centre director's award for the youngest
prticipant of the competition.
The Jury has the right of final distribution of the statutory
prizes, change of their amount, or non-awarding them or non-awarding
the GRAND PRIX SATYRYKON. Jury's decisions are final. The
